What is HBOT?


HBOT involves breathing pure oxygen in a pressurized environment. This increases the amount of oxygen dissolved in the bloodstream, which can have a variety of therapeutic benefits. HBOT is traditionally used to treat conditions such as decompression sickness, carbon monoxide poisoning, and gas gangrene.

Technological Advancements in Hyperbaric Chambers

Modern hyperbaric chambers are far more sophisticated than their predecessors. Here are some of the key technological advancements:

  • Personalized pressure settings: Chambers can now be customized to deliver different levels of pressure, depending on the patient's needs. This allows for more targeted and effective treatment.
  • Controlled oxygen levels: The oxygen concentration in the chamber can also be controlled, allowing for adjustments based on the specific condition being treated.
  • Health monitoring: Advanced chambers are equipped with sensors that monitor the patient's vital signs during treatment. This allows the medical team to make sure the patient is safe and comfortable.
  • Data analysis: Many chambers now collect data on the patient's response to treatment. This data can be used to personalize future treatments and track progress over time.

How Modern Hyperbaric Chambers Are Transforming Medicine

The technological advancements in HBOT are leading to a number of exciting breakthroughs in medicine. Here are a few examples:

  • Treatment of chronic conditions: HBOT is showing promise in the treatment of a variety of chronic conditions, such as diabetes, stroke, and traumatic brain injury.
  • Enhanced wound healing: The increased oxygen levels in the chamber can promote wound healing, making HBOT a valuable tool for patients with burns, diabetic ulcers, and other chronic wounds.
  • Improved athletic performance: Some athletes are using HBOT to improve their recovery time and performance.
